Internal Controls and your Company
When a company is considering going public, the company would have to adhere to the many sanctions and requirements of the Sarbanes Oxley Act of 2002. The SOX requires the documentation of controls and external auditors to test controls and reports on the effectiveness of these controls. The SOX requires that the annual reports of public corporations include reports by management as well as the external auditors, certifying the adequacy and effectiveness of the companys internal controls. Internal control is defined as a process affected by an organizations structure, work and authority flows, people and management information systems, designed to help the organization accomplish specific goals or objectives. Also, there are some great physical controls in effect that secures the companys payroll checks from being stolen/lost. Pre-numbered invoices for transactions are mandatory to have in place. SOX requires mechanical and electronic controls to safeguard assets and enhance the accuracy and reliability of the accounting records. I believe that the idea of purchasing an indelible ink machine would be beneficial to have with the company in order to help the managers control the printing and writing of checks. Pre-numbered checks are easier to manage especially when the company writes hundreds of checks each month and its more professional for the company to be able to track checks that have been cleared, lost, or stolen. Documents should be pre-numbered because this provides evidence that transactions and events have occurred.
